Stockton on Tees Borough Council
Accelerated Affordable Housing on Council Owned Sites

Stockton-on-Tees Borough Council is engaging with Registered Providers (RPs) to understand interest in an Accelerated Affordable Housing project on 3 Council owned pilot sites.
The role taken by the Council to encourage the provision of new affordable housing in the borough, has not been sufficient to address the Boroughs housing needs, and this is particularly evident in the lack of new build 1 bed properties.
A pipeline of 1 bedroom units is critical to support the successful move on of our care leavers, vulnerable adult and homeless households who are ready to move to living independently.
Without access to sufficient affordable housing numbers the Council will inevitably face increasing budget pressures across these key service areas.
The following 3 sites have been identified for disposal for affordable housing delivery: Londonderry Road Stirling House Parkside Resource Centre
